Web27 jun. 2024 · A GST Invoice must have the following mandatory fields- Invoice number and date Customer name Shipping and billing address Customer and taxpayer’s GSTIN (if registered)** Place of … Web15 nov. 2024 · Relaxations Provided for GST Bill of Supply. The value is less than ₹200: If the value of goods or services or both is less than ₹200, then a Bill of supply is not required; Non-requirement of signature or digital signature: There is no requirement for a signature or digital signature when a bill of supply is issued digitally or electronically.

There are two ways to account for GST: … open chrome in safe mode windows 11Web27 jan. 2024 · GST law applies as a single domestic indirect tax law for the entire country. Further, the GST has replaced many indirect taxes, such as excise duty, value added tax (VAT), service tax, etc. It came into effect from July 1, 2024. GST is technically paid by suppliers but its ultimate burden is carried over to final consumers. open chrome web store chromeWebStep 1: Identifying GST Invoice Filter While searching, always use the GST Invoice filter to see items that have GST compliant invoice.
